Benefits and drawbacks of Prescription Options
Prescription options for acne therapy featured both advantages and drawbacks that you should evaluate carefully.
One major pro is their potency. Prescription drugs often contain greater focus of energetic ingredients, which can bring about faster and much more efficient outcomes compared to over the counter (OTC) products. You could additionally locate that prescriptions are tailored to your details skin type and acne severity, giving a more customized approach.
On the other hand, these therapies can include substantial drawbacks. For one, they may have adverse effects varying from light irritation to a lot more major problems, which you need to keep track of very closely.
Additionally, prescription therapies can be a lot more costly, particularly if your insurance policy doesn't cover them. You might also encounter obstacles in getting a prescription, as it needs a check out to a healthcare provider, which can be time-consuming and troublesome.
Benefits of OTC Therapies
OTC treatments typically offer a practical and accessible service for managing acne. You can easily find these items in drug stores, supermarket, or online, making them readily available without a prescription. This ease of access suggests you can begin your acne therapy whenever you need to, without waiting on a medical professional's appointment.
One more substantial advantage of OTC treatments is their cost. Lots of over the counter options are economical, enabling you to discover various formulations without breaking the financial institution. You can attempt different products to see what jobs best for your skin type.
OTC therapies likewise are available in a variety of formulas, including gels, creams, and washes. This variety permits you to select an item that fits your way of living and preferences. Many contain energetic ingredients like benzoyl peroxide or salicylic acid, which work in treating acne.
